For this week's sync: the Corelume component library now publishes immutable, provenance-attested versions. Each release embeds the exact source revision, the builder image digest, and the full dependency lockfile, so any consuming team can reproduce a version byte-for-byte. Never pin to a floating tag — only to attested versions, which the Ledgerline service verifies at fetch time. Consumers mixing versions across a single app must justify it in the compatibility register. The current attested release is identified below.

session token of fahap-hawip = htk31_7852f2b3276dba2738f98fa97f92237

**Runbook — Telemetry compression on Grayfen Collect**

When ingest volume spikes, we compress telemetry payloads at the edge relay before they reach the Grayfen aggregator. Enable this by setting `TELEMETRY_CODEC=zstd` and `TELEMETRY_CHUNK_KB=256` in the relay's env file. Compressed batches are signed so the aggregator can verify they weren't altered in transit; without a valid signature the batch is quarantined. New team members: after the two codec lines above, append the signing key entry on its own line.

sealed setting: VAULT_KEY20=c8ea1e419912889df6b4

Release checklist — Harborlane password reset revamp. Before flipping the flag: verify reset emails render on the Nettle template engine, confirm token expiry is 15 minutes (not the old 60), and check that in-flight resets issued under the legacy flow still validate for 24 hours. If reset success rate drops below 92% in the first hour, roll back via the Lampwick console. Record the deploy against the build token below.

trace token, fafog-kageg: htk4_98e6

Handing over Velocirack DBA duties before I'm out Friday. Reviewer should know: the rebalancing tool writes dock forecasts hourly; replication lag over 30s means skipped cycles, not errors, so watch the gap metric. Vacuum schedule was moved to 03:00. Nothing else pending except the index rebuild on trips. Staging access for review runs goes through the connection string below.

primary connection of yagep-kahip = redis://giliel_svc:zYiKsLL2PLpfPL@db-348f.xolmarsys.corp:5432/fenwyn